Braciole

Total Time: 6 hours
Yield: 4 Servings

Ingredients
1 pound Top Round Beef (thinly sliced, 6 pieces)
6 cloves Garlic (4 sliced, 2 minced)
1⁄4 cup Parsley (chopped)
2 tablespoons Basil (chopped)
1⁄2 cup Parmesan (shredded)
2 tablespoons Seasoned Bread Crumbs
6 whole Prosciutto (sliced)
3 tablespoons Currants
2 tablespoons Olive Oil
1 cup Red Wine
1 cup Beef Broth
1 1⁄2 teaspoon Italian Seasoning
15 ounces Crushed Tomatoes
  dash Salt
  dash Ground Black Pepper

Directions
  1. Place the slices of meat on a sheet of plastic wrap, then top with a second sheet. Pound the meat thin using a mallet or a rolling pin.
  2. Prepare the filling by combining the minced garlic, parsley, basil, parmesan, bread crumbs, and dash of salt and pepper, mixing well.
  3. Place a slice of prosciutto on each thinly pounded slice of beef. Cover the prosciutto evenly with the filling mixture. Then roll each piece up, securing with toothpicks.
  4. Heat oil in a large skillet. Once the oil is hot, add the braciole and brown them evenly on all sides. Be careful not to disturb or spill the filling when you turn them.
  5. Carefully remove the browned braciole and place them in a slow cooker insert. Add the sliced garlic, red wine, beef broth, crushed tomatoes, and Italian seasoning, then mix well.
  6. Cook on high for 5 hours, turning the braciole occasionally.
